What gambling policies most gambler ignore when it comes to responsible gambling ?
 
There are several gambling policies that many gamblers tend to ignore when it comes to responsible gambling. Here are a few examples:

1. Setting Limits: Many gamblers forget or choose to ignore setting limits on their gambling activities. This includes setting a budget before starting to play and sticking to it, as well as setting time limits for gambling sessions. By not adhering to these limits, gamblers may find themselves spending more money or time than they can afford.

2. Self-Exclusion Programs: Most gambling operators offer self-exclusion programs that allow players to voluntarily exclude themselves from gambling for a specified period. However, many gamblers ignore this policy and continue to gamble even if they know they have a gambling problem. By not taking advantage of self-exclusion programs, they put themselves at risk of exacerbating their gambling issues.

3. Age Restrictions: It is crucial for gamblers to adhere to age restrictions imposed by gambling establishments. These restrictions are in place to protect vulnerable individuals, such as minors, from the harms of gambling. However, some gamblers may try to circumvent these policies by using false identification or by accessing online gambling sites that do not enforce proper age verification.

4. Chasing Losses: One common pitfall that gamblers often ignore is the practice of chasing losses. This means that when a gambler experiences losses, they may try to recoup them by continuing to gamble in the hopes of winning back their money. This behavior can quickly spiral out of control and lead to significant financial and emotional consequences.

5. Sharing Account Information: Many online gambling platforms require users to create an account to access their services. However, gamblers often ignore the policy of not sharing their account information with others. Sharing account details can lead to unauthorized access and potentially result in financial loss or misuse of personal information.

It is crucial for gamblers to take these policies seriously and prioritize responsible gambling. By doing so, they can minimize the risks associated with gambling and maintain a safe and enjoyable experience.
